From Files of Justice to Legal Entanglement, TVB has found quite a bit of success with legal dramas, and one of the most memorable recent entries in the genre has to be the 2003 series Survivor's Law. Featuring four up-and-coming stars in the leading roles, Survivor's Law turned into a surprisingly big hit, confirming the rise of TVB's next generation. Raymond Lam, Sammul Chan, Myolie Wu, and Bernice Liu star as rookie lawyers of very different backgrounds and personalities who end up at the same law firm and battle out challenging court cases together. The entertaining drama's great supporting cast includes veterans Hui Siu Hung, Liu Kai Chi, Felix Lok, and Helen Tam; other young stars like Sharon Chan, Chris Lai, Kenneth Ma, and singer Juno Mak in his one TVB drama; and movie actress Ruby Wong in a rare television appearance. Survivor's Law returned for a second season in 2007 with a slightly different cast.

With his casual dress, unconventional work methods, and laidback attitude, Lok Bun (Raymond Lam) doesn't exactly fit into the usual image of a lawyer, but he has a warm heart and a head full of unexpected ideas. The polar opposite of Lok Bun, Ching Ling (Myolie Wu) is extremely serious and thorough about her work, but sometimes lets emotions affect her judgment. A rising star in the field, the ambitious and strong-minded Wai Ming (Sammul Chan) becomes colleagues with Lok Bun and Ching Ling because he wants to escape the restrictions and hierarchy of a big firm. Completing the team is timid Si Ga (Bernice Liu) who puts love before work. The four young lawyers go through the trials and triumphs of practicing law together, but their friendship is put to the test by romantic conflicts, career ambitions, and cases that hit too close to home.
